[37] The Drummond light is produced by the ignition or combustion of
a ball of lime (³⁄₈ inch diameter) in the united flames of hydrogen
and oxygen gases, and is equal to about 264 flames of an ordinary
Argand Lamp with the best Spermaceti oil. It derives its name from
the late LIEUT. DRUMMOND, R. E., who first applied it in the focus of
a paraboloïd for geodetical purposes, and afterwards proposed it for
Lighthouses. (See his Account of the Light in the Phil. Trans. for
1826, p. 324, and for 1830, p. 383.) The Voltaic light is obtained
by passing a stream of Voltaic electricity from a powerful battery
between two _charcoal points_, the distance between which requires
great nicety of adjustment, and is the chief circumstance which
influences the stability and the permanency of the light. The Voltaic
light greatly exceeds the Drummond light in intensity, as ascertained
by actual comparison of their effects; but the ratio of their power
has not been accurately determined. It was first exhibited in the
focus of a reflector by Mr JAMES GARDNER, formerly engaged in the
Ordnance Survey of Great Britain.
~Mr Gurney’s Lamp.~
In 1835, Mr GURNEY proposed the combination of a current of oxygen with
the flame of oil, in order to obtain a powerful light of sufficient
size to produce the divergence required for the illumination of
lighthouses. The Trinity-House of London entertained the proposal,
and made some experiments on this important subject; but the plan was
finally rejected as disadvantageous in practice.
